6 Benefits of Hiring a Certified HVAC Technician

Don’t slip and make the error of employing an unlicensed contractor to service or replace your HVAC system. Here’s why you benefit from selecting a certified pro for the job:

  • Dependable installation and repair work: With years of industry experience and innovative tools and techniques at their disposal, the best technicians have the expertise to set up and service your HVAC system according to best results. Their attention to detail reduces the risk of subsequent issues popping up at some point, and extends your equipment’s service life.
  • Warranty protection: Many HVAC brands require certified technicians to perform installations and repairs to keep warranty coverage. As a result, hiring a certified technician can impact how you’re protecting your home comfort system.
  • Ensuring safety and code compliance: Certified technicians are proficient in safety protocols and applicable building codes. This crucial knowledge helps reduce potential risks and ensures your system is always compliant.
  • Easily proven body of expertise: Certified technicians have experienced years of training, apprenticeships and exams, allowing them to hone the knowledge and skills needed to handle any HVAC issue they run into.
  • Peace of mind: Knowing that a licensed and insured professional is managing your HVAC service needs is how you enjoy that priceless peace of mind. You can rest easy that the work will be done right the first time, saving you effort, money and stress in the long run.
  • Meeting industry standards: HVAC contractors are required by federal law to be EPA-certified if they handle refrigerants. Most states and employers also require HVAC technicians to complete at least one other certification to confirm their skills and knowledge. Make this a personal requirement when comparing different companies to ensure you choose a professional that fulfills or even surpasses industry standards.

The Educational Requirements for Certified HVAC Professionals

Extensive on-the-job training and development are required to become a certified HVAC technician. These usually include the following phases:

  1. Formal training: Many HVAC professionals start with a diploma or associate degree from a trade school or community college. These courses usually take six months up to two years and review the basics of heating and cooling systems as well as electrical work and even refrigeration.
  • Apprenticeships: Supervised experience is crucial for any trade. Apprenticeships, which generally last three to five years, combine hands-on learning with classroom instruction. Apprentices will be guided by more experienced staff to acquire real-world knowledge right away.
  • Licensing certifications: As soon as they finish a formal training and apprenticeship program, aspiring technicians must pass state or local licensing exams, putting their recent education of HVAC systems, safety protocols and building codes to the test.

Types of HVAC Licenses and Certifications

HVAC technicians may seek various certifications that boost their skills and reputation. Some of the most common and esteemed options consist of:

  • NATE certification: The North American Technician Excellence (NATE) certification is a widely recognized credential. It demonstrates a technician’s expertise in different HVAC fields, such as air conditioning, heat pumps and gas furnaces.
  • HVAC Excellence certification: This program provides a variety of credentials for different experience levels, from entry-level technicians to senior-level professionals.
  • EPA certification: The Environmental Protection Agency requires all HVAC technicians who manage refrigerants to be certified. EPA certification ensures they comprehend how to securely and legally manage these potentially ozone-depleting compounds.
  • RSES certification: The Refrigeration Service Engineers Society offers certifications focused on refrigeration and HVAC systems.
